Anisotropy of the semi-classical gluon field of a large nucleus at high energy

Published 24 Nov 2014 in hep-ph and nucl-th | (1411.6630v3)

Abstract: The McLerran-Venugopalan model describes a highly boosted hadron/nucleus as a sheet of random color charges which source soft classical Weizs\"acker-Williams gluon fields. We show that due to fluctuations, individual configurations are azimuthally anisotropic. We present initial evidence that impact parameter dependent small-x JIMWLK resummation preserves such anisotropies over several units of rapidity. Finally, we compute the first four azimuthal Fourier amplitudes of the S-matrix of a fundamental dipole in such background fields.
